This article needs additional citations for verification. Please help improve this article by adding citations to reliable sources. Unsourced material may be challenged and removed. Find sources: "Locomotive BASIC" – news · newspapers · books · scholar · JSTOR(December 2009) (Learn how and when to remove this message)
Locomotive BASIC
First appeared
1984; 40 years ago (1984)
OS
AMSDOS
License
Proprietary
Influenced by
Mallard BASIC
BBC BASIC
Preview warning: Page using Template:Infobox programming language with unknown parameter "caption"
Locomotive Basic is a proprietary dialect of the BASIC programming language written by Locomotive Software on the Amstrad CPC (where it was built-in on ROM) and the later Locomotive BASIC-2 as a GEM application on the Amstrad PC1512 and 1640. It was the main descendant of Mallard BASIC,[1] the interpreter for CP/M supplied with the Amstrad PCW.
There are two versions of Locomotive BASIC: 1.0 which only came with the CPC model 464, and 1.1 which shipped with all other versions. BASIC 1.1 was also shipped with the Amstrad CPC Plus series machines, as part of the included game cartridge.
^Smith, Tony (12 February 2014). "You're NOT fired: The story of Amstrad's amazing CPC 464". The Register. Retrieved 17 February 2014.
LocomotiveBasic is a proprietary dialect of the BASIC programming language written by Locomotive Software on the Amstrad CPC (where it was built-in on...
has its OS and a BASIC interpreter built in as ROM. It uses LocomotiveBASIC - an improved version of Locomotive Software's Z80 BASIC for the BBC Micro...
machines, amongst others. Its LocomotiveBASIC for the CPC range was a fast and highly featured implementation of BASIC for the time and later led to...
Mallard BASIC is a BASIC interpreter for CP/M produced by Locomotive Software and supplied with the Amstrad PCW range of small business computers, the...
WordBasic (pre-VBA) (MS Windows) Atari BASIC BBC BASIC Integer BASICLocomotiveBASIC An Open Letter to Hobbyists Tiny BASIC Sources differ in regard to the...
A steam locomotive is a locomotive that provides the force to move itself and other vehicles by means of the expansion of steam.: 80 It is fuelled by...
changed to 16. MSX BASIC, QuickBASIC, FreeBASIC and Visual Basic prefix hexadecimal numbers with &H: &H5A3 BBC BASIC and LocomotiveBASIC use & for hex. TI-89...
A diesel locomotive is a type of railway locomotive in which the power source is a diesel engine. Several types of diesel locomotives have been developed...
geared steam locomotives do not use the notation. They are classified by their model and their number of trucks. The notation in its basic form counts...
Research DOS Plus (runs MS-DOS and CP/M-86 applications) GEM-based LocomotiveBASIC 2 The system was also bundled with the Amstrad PC Games Collection...
machine ROM, depending on model) and was accessible through the built-in LocomotiveBASIC as well as through firmware routines. Its main function was to map...
for system programming in Inferno (operating system) LocomotiveBASIC—Amstrad variant of BASIC contains EVERY and AFTER commands for concurrent subroutines...
BASIC (Amstrad PCW, ZX Spectrum +3 on CP/M) – Similar to LocomotiveBASIC MapBasic procedural language used specifically for GIS programs. MasmBasic over...
Clayton, Chris Hall, and Paul Overell developed Mallard BASIC for the BBC Micro and LocomotiveBASIC for the Amstrad CPC, both supporting commands for an...
The Shay locomotive is a geared steam locomotive that originated and was primarily used in North America. The locomotives were built to the patents of...
the Amstrad CPC 464 in 1986. "Tab Composer CPC" was implemented in LocomotiveBASIC 1.0. It offered a multi-page graphical WYSIWYG, 3channel polyphonic...
32722°W / 39.85917; -75.32722 Baldwin Locomotive Works (BLW) was an American manufacturer of railway locomotives from 1825 to 1951. Originally located...
The 5AT Advanced Technology steam locomotive was a conceptual design conceived by the British engineer David Wardale, and first described in his 1998 definitive...
A fireless locomotive is a type of locomotive which uses reciprocating engines powered from a reservoir of compressed air or steam, which is filled at...
A Climax locomotive is a type of geared steam locomotive built by the Climax Manufacturing Company (later renamed to the Climax Locomotive Works), of...